The tour begins in Piazza Giacomo Matteotti, a central spot overlooking the lake. From here, the drive departs with a short briefing about the route and what to expect. Then, the journey along the lakeside begins, passing by some of Lake Como’s most renowned sights.
Throughout the 2 hours, you’ll cruise past Villa Olmo, an elegant neoclassical estate built by architect Simone Cantoni. While the villa isn’t part of the stop, it’s a striking sight from the road. The same goes for Villa Erba, a prominent early 20th-century mansion with impressive architecture. Both villas are impressive from the outside, and many guests love snapping photos from the car or at designated stops.
As the drive continues through charming villages like Cernobbio, Moltrasio, and Carate Urio, the scenery shifts between lush gardens, colorful houses, and centuries-old churches. Cernobbio is often a hub for the wealthy and famous, and guests frequently mention the “beautiful hotels and villas” as a highlight.
While the tour primarily passes by these sites, there are opportunities to pause—if you wish—to take photos or briefly explore. Notably, the route includes Laglio, George Clooney’s well-known residence at Villa Oleandra, and Sala Comacina, where the only island on Lake Como is visible from the shore. One guest commented, “Seeing Clooney’s villa from the road really added a special touch to the experience,” highlighting the personalized nature of this tour.
You’ll also pass through Argegno, a lovely lakeside town famous for its small square and cable car to the mountains. It’s known for its relaxed vibe and scenic views, making it an ideal spot for a quick photo stop.

Is this tour suitable for all ages?
Yes, most travelers can participate, making it an accessible experience for couples, friends, and small families.
What is included in the price?
Your private group has exclusive use of the vintage BMW convertible and the driver. The tour includes several scenic stops and photo opportunities, with a well-stocked minibar in the car.
Can I stop anywhere on the route?
Yes, you’re free to request stops at any point along the route for photos or brief explorations, making it flexible to your preferences.
How long is the tour?
The experience lasts approximately 2 hours, covering a scenic route along the western side of Lake Como.
What if the weather is bad?
The tour requires good weather. If canceled due to poor conditions, you’ll be offered a different date or a full refund.
Is the tour private?
Absolutely. Only your group will participate, ensuring a personalized experience.
How many people can join the tour?
Up to 3 people can participate per booking, making it a cozy, intimate experience perfect for small groups or couples.
